__FP_CLZ
#define count_leading_zeros __FP_CLZ
#define _FP_FRAC_CLZ_1(z, X) __FP_CLZ(z, X##_f)
__FP_CLZ(R,X##_f1); \
__FP_CLZ(R,X##_f0); \
__FP_CLZ(R,xh); \
__FP_CLZ(R,xl); \
__FP_CLZ(R,X##_f[3]); \
__FP_CLZ(R,X##_f[2]); \
__FP_CLZ(R,X##_f[2]); \
__FP_CLZ(R,X##_f[0]); \
? ({ __FP_CLZ(X##_e, ur_); }) \
#ifndef __FP_CLZ